Transaction ecb744a7112a93b121758f1989dda431fdab1b98ca372785c2ba09e2e8e3982f
1 Input
1 Output
-
ecb744a7112a93b121758f1989dda431fdab1b98ca372785c2ba09e2e8e3982f:0
- value
- 509669
- script pubkey
- OP_0 OP_PUSHBYTES_32 fd52c3e94e0c00f60bb0dd6bbe4507289eef3b572697f7035015db2e94deef6d
- address
- bc1ql4fv862wpsq0vzasm44mu3g89z0w7w6hy6tlwq6szhdja9x7aakswdpc0d